I really wish I could’ve written about any other day. But the prompt says today and that’s what you’re getting.

My alarm went off at 7 am and after turning it off, I lay in bed, thinking and feeling happy it was a Sunday and I didn’t have to rush through the morning. Finally, I was up and about around 8 am feeling just a bit guilty but also consoling myself it was okay since I had the ’flu. Didn’t check my blood sugar as scheduled, postponing it to tomorrow. Checked my weight (not telling you though) and noted it in the app and then, I went off to do my happiest thing of the day. Make coffee.

Humming prayers (we call them slokas) I brought in the milk-bag from the door and poured it into a utensil for boiling. Then I added rich coffee powder to my coffee filter and heated the water. When it came to a boil, I poured it over the coffee powder and listened for the “tik tik tik” the sound of coffee percolating. I put a pan of water on the third stove to boil 2 eggs for breakfast.
